diff --git a/.gitattributes b/.gitattributes index c14f4711503..88d06a702e3 100644 --- a/.gitattributes +++ b/.gitattributes @@ -4857,7 +4857,6 @@ res/cardsfolder/l/lys_alana_bowmaster.txt svneol=native#text/plain res/cardsfolder/l/lys_alana_huntmaster.txt svneol=native#text/plain res/cardsfolder/l/lys_alana_scarblade.txt -text res/cardsfolder/l/lyzolda_the_blood_witch.txt svneol=native#text/plain -res/cardsfolder/l/veilstone_amulet.txt -text res/cardsfolder/m/ma_chao_western_warrior.txt svneol=native#text/plain res/cardsfolder/m/macabre_waltz.txt svneol=native#text/plain res/cardsfolder/m/macetail_hystrodon.txt svneol=native#text/plain @@ -8983,6 +8982,7 @@ res/cardsfolder/v/vedalken_shackles.txt svneol=native#text/plain res/cardsfolder/v/veil_of_birds.txt svneol=native#text/plain res/cardsfolder/v/veiled_apparition.txt svneol=native#text/plain res/cardsfolder/v/veiled_serpent.txt svneol=native#text/plain +res/cardsfolder/v/veilstone_amulet.txt -text res/cardsfolder/v/vein_drinker.txt svneol=native#text/plain res/cardsfolder/v/veinfire_borderpost.txt svneol=native#text/plain res/cardsfolder/v/veldrane_of_sengir.txt svneol=native#text/plain diff --git a/res/cardsfolder/d/dralnu_lich_lord.txt b/res/cardsfolder/d/dralnu_lich_lord.txt index b7a94f31f07..81ba1cac597 100644 --- a/res/cardsfolder/d/dralnu_lich_lord.txt +++ b/res/cardsfolder/d/dralnu_lich_lord.txt @@ -4,6 +4,7 @@ Types:Legendary Creature Zombie Wizard Text:If damage would be dealt to Dralnu, Lich Lord, sacrifice that many permanents instead. PT:3/3 A:AB$Pump | Cost$ T | ValidTgts$ Instant.YouCtrl,Sorcery.YouCtrl | KW$ Flashback | TgtZone$ Graveyard | PumpZone$ Graveyard | SpellDescription$ Target instant or sorcery card in your graveyard gains flashback until end of turn. The flashback cost is equal to its mana cost. (You may cast that card from your graveyard for its flashback cost. Then exile it.) +SVar:RemAIDeck:True SVar:Rarity:Rare SVar:Picture:http://www.wizards.com/global/images/magic/general/dralnu_lich_lord.jpg SetInfo:TSP|Rare|http://magiccards.info/scans/en/ts/237.jpg diff --git a/res/cardsfolder/l/veilstone_amulet.txt b/res/cardsfolder/v/veilstone_amulet.txt similarity index 100% rename from res/cardsfolder/l/veilstone_amulet.txt rename to res/cardsfolder/v/veilstone_amulet.txt diff --git a/src/main/java/forge/card/abilityfactory/AbilityFactoryClash.java b/src/main/java/forge/card/abilityfactory/AbilityFactoryClash.java index f6a96936081..226980c774b 100644 --- a/src/main/java/forge/card/abilityfactory/AbilityFactoryClash.java +++ b/src/main/java/forge/card/abilityfactory/AbilityFactoryClash.java @@ -9,7 +9,6 @@ import javax.swing.JOptionPane; import forge.AllZone; import forge.Card; import forge.CardList; -import forge.CardUtil; import forge.Constant.Zone; import forge.GameActionUtil; import forge.Player; diff --git a/src/main/java/forge/card/abilityfactory/AbilityFactoryDebuff.java b/src/main/java/forge/card/abilityfactory/AbilityFactoryDebuff.java index 67d5a8f6d9d..7c4f5d1fd4d 100644 --- a/src/main/java/forge/card/abilityfactory/AbilityFactoryDebuff.java +++ b/src/main/java/forge/card/abilityfactory/AbilityFactoryDebuff.java @@ -400,7 +400,6 @@ public final class AbilityFactoryDebuff { */ private static CardList getCurseCreatures(final AbilityFactory af, final SpellAbility sa, final ArrayList kws) { - final Card hostCard = af.getHostCard(); CardList list = AllZoneUtil.getCreaturesInPlay(AllZone.getHumanPlayer()); list = list.getTargetableCards(sa); diff --git a/src/main/java/forge/card/abilityfactory/AbilityFactoryDestroy.java b/src/main/java/forge/card/abilityfactory/AbilityFactoryDestroy.java index 53d2234e79b..378c1eefb6c 100644 --- a/src/main/java/forge/card/abilityfactory/AbilityFactoryDestroy.java +++ b/src/main/java/forge/card/abilityfactory/AbilityFactoryDestroy.java @@ -480,7 +480,6 @@ public class AbilityFactoryDestroy { final boolean noRegen = params.containsKey("NoRegen"); final boolean sac = params.containsKey("Sacrifice"); - final Card card = sa.getSourceCard(); ArrayList tgtCards; final ArrayList untargetedCards = new ArrayList(); diff --git a/src/main/java/forge/card/spellability/AbilityActivated.java b/src/main/java/forge/card/spellability/AbilityActivated.java index 26c69e9159d..4ac12010e0e 100644 --- a/src/main/java/forge/card/spellability/AbilityActivated.java +++ b/src/main/java/forge/card/spellability/AbilityActivated.java @@ -73,8 +73,6 @@ public abstract class AbilityActivated extends SpellAbility implements java.io.S return false; } - final Player activator = this.getActivatingPlayer(); - // CantBeActivated static abilities final CardList allp = AllZoneUtil.getCardsIn(Zone.Battlefield); for (final Card ca : allp) { diff --git a/src/main/java/forge/card/spellability/Target.java b/src/main/java/forge/card/spellability/Target.java index b61e9405ae8..95d21b52aed 100644 --- a/src/main/java/forge/card/spellability/Target.java +++ b/src/main/java/forge/card/spellability/Target.java @@ -9,7 +9,6 @@ import forge.Card; import forge.Constant; import forge.Player; import forge.card.abilityfactory.AbilityFactory; -import forge.card.cardfactory.CardFactoryUtil; /** *